Understanding Item Liability

What Is Item Liability?

Product liability refers to the legal duty suppliers and vendors have when their items create injury to customers. This location of law encompasses three primary kinds of flaws:

Manufacturing Defects: Defects that occur throughout the manufacturing process. Design Defects: Issues arising from an unsafe layout that makes an item dangerous. Failure to Warn: When manufacturers stop working to supply ample warnings or instructions for secure use.

Each type provides distinct obstacles and requires a tailored lawful approach.

Delaware's Strict Responsibility Laws

What Are Rigorous Liability Product Claims?

Under Delaware regulation, rigorous obligation holds producers and vendors liable for injuries caused by defective products despite intent or neglect. This implies if you are harmed by a defective product, you might not need to verify carelessness; you only need to show that the product was malfunctioning and created your injury.

Dangerous Medication Injury Claims

Understanding Drug Injury in Delaware

Dangerous medicines can inflict life-altering effects on customers. Pharmaceutical firms have an obligation to ensure their items are safe prior to bringing them to market; failure to do so can lead to considerable cases versus them.

Types of Dangerous Drug Injuries

Side Effects: Adverse responses that were not disclosed. Medication Errors: Mislabeling or incorrect dosages resulting in harm. Drug Interactions: Hazardous communications between recommended drugs not properly warned against.
